Binary packages built by this source

ubuntustudio-default-settings: default settings for the Ubuntu Studio desktop

 This package contains the default settings used by Ubuntu Studio. It sets
 the session name, menu icon, backdrops for lightdm and the session. It
 sets grub to default to the latest lowlatency kernel even if a newer
 generic kernel exists. It also sets various audio related system settings.

ubuntustudio-lowlatency-settings: Adds lowlatency kernel as boot default if available

 This package makes the lowlatency kernel the default kernel in GRUB.
 Also adds a second entry for the generic kernel if available.

ubuntustudio-performance-tweaks: Under-the-hood tweaks for Ubuntu Studio performance

 This package makes the necessary system performance tweaks for Ubuntu
 users that wish to gain the benefits of Ubuntu Studio, such as realtime
 audio access for members of the audio group.
